CVE-2026-24295: Patch Windows Device Association Service Local Privilege Escalation

  • Thread Author
Microsoft has recorded CVE-2026-24295 as an Important local elevation‑of‑privilege vulnerability in the Windows Device Association Service (service name: DeviceAssociation), and administrators should treat the entry as a verified vendor advisory while urgently mapping it to their SKU-specific updates and deployment plans. (msrc.microsoft.com)

Background / Overview​

The Windows Device Association Service is a long‑standing, inbox system service used to broker device‑pairing and companion‑device workflows (Nearby Sharing, Bluetooth pairing ceremonies, device setup assistants and related UX flows). Because it mediates requests between user‑mode components and device‑management stacks, flaws in its synchronization or input handling can expose privileged code paths to attacker control. Microsoft’s advisory entry for CVE‑2026‑24295 names the service as the affected component and marks the issue as an elevation‑of‑privilege risk that requires local, authorized access to exploit. (msrc.microsoft.com)
This advisory appears in the March 2026 Patch Tuesday set and has been enumerated in independent vulnerability trackers and Patch Tuesday roundups, which list CVE‑2026‑24295 alongside multiple other Windows EoP fixes issued on March 10, 2026. Those trackers reproduce the vendor’s short technical summary and the CVSS scoring used for prioritization.

What the advisory says — technical summary​

  • The root cause is reported as a race condition / improper synchronization in the Device Association Service that can be triggered by concurrent execution using a shared resource. Exploitation allows a locally authorized attacker to elevate privileges on an affected host.
  • Microsoft classifies the bug as an Elevation‑of‑Privilege vulnerability. The vendor’s tracking entry and third‑party aggregators list the severity as Important with a CVSS v3 base score in the high‑6 to 7.0 range — a score consistent with a locally exploitable EoP that cannot be weaponized remotely without additional footholds. (msrc.microsoft.com)
  • Exploitation requirements: local, authorized user access and the ability to trigger the race; no public proof‑of‑concept (PoC) has been published at disclosure and there is no public evidence of active exploitation at the time of reporting. That lowers immediate, widespread risk but does not remove the urgency — EoP vulnerabilities are prized by attackers for post‑compromise escalation.
These three technical points — race condition root cause, local authorization requirement, and absence of public PoC — are the load‑bearing facts for defenders deciding triage and deployment strategy. Each is corroborated in independent trackers and news coverage summarizing the March 2026 Patch Tuesday release.

Why the Device Association surface matters​

The Device Association stack touches UX and device lifecycle code paths that often run with elevated privileges or act as brokers between user‑facing apps and system‑level drivers. Historically, Microsoft has fixed multiple elevation‑of‑privilege bugs in connected‑device and device‑association components across 2024–2025, underlining that these services are attractive targets for attackers seeking lateral movement or persistence on modern endpoints. For example, Microsoft previously remedied an untrusted pointer dereference in the Device Association Broker service (CVE‑2025‑55677), illustrating a pattern of memory‑safety and synchronization issues in the overall device association area.
Attackers who already control an account on a host — for example via phishing, credential reuse, or a separate client‑side exploit — often need a reliable elevation path to SYSTEM to plant services, disable protections, or access other user profiles. That’s why even a local‑only EoP, particularly one that’s relatively easy to trigger, is operationally valuable and high priority to remediate.

Technical analysis: what a race condition in DeviceAssociation could mean​

A race condition in a service like Device Association typically arises when multiple threads or processes access and modify a shared resource without correct locking, reference counting, or validation. In practice, that can produce several exploitable outcomes:
  • Use‑after‑free or stale pointer dereferences, where an attacker times operations so an object is freed and reallocated under attacker control before the service accesses it again. That can allow arbitrary memory corruption in the privileged process.
  • Improper access checks, where the timing of checks versus use (TOCTOU — time of check to time of use) lets an attacker interpose malicious data after a permission check but before the privileged operation executes.
  • State confusion, where concurrent sequences cause privilege assumptions to be violated (for example, a data structure marked as “trusted” at one instant and “untrusted” the next).
CVE‑2026‑24295’s short description — “concurrent execution using shared resource with improper synchronization” — most directly maps to these classes of race‑related flaws. Race conditions are frequently harder to reproduce reliably than straightforward memory bugs, which in turn can delay publication of PoC code; that matches the advisory’s lack of public exploit code at disclosure. However, once a reliable exploitation primitive is found, the consequences can be severe because the code path runs with elevated privileges.

Assessing exploitability and attacker incentives​

  • Attack complexity: Microsoft and third‑party trackers indicate higher attack complexity — the exploit demands precise timing (which is typical for race conditions) and requires local code execution already. This positions CVE‑2026‑24295 as a post‑compromise escalation vector rather than an initial access vector.
  • Value to attackers: Once local code execution exists (for example, an unprivileged shell spawned by malware), gaining SYSTEM via a reliable EoP unlocks broad capabilities across the host and the network. Adversaries performing targeted intrusions — ransomware, data exfiltration, and advanced persistence campaigns — prize such vulnerabilities. The absence of PoC only slows exploitation, not the incentive to weaponize the flaw.
  • Likelihood of weaponization: Historically, race‑condition EoPs can be weaponized by skilled actors and researcher communities. Given the March 2026 patch availability and the lack of public PoC, the near‑term risk is mitigated, but defenders should not assume exploitation is impossible or unlikely in aggressive threat environments.

Vendor confidence and what it means for defenders​

Microsoft’s Security Response Center (MSRC) publishes a “confidence” signal that expresses how certain the vendor is about the technical details and exploitability of an advisory entry. That metric ranges from low (existence noted, details incomplete) to high (root cause verified, vendor patch available). The MSRC entry for CVE‑2026‑24295 is a confirmed vendor advisory in the official update guide, which means Microsoft recognizes the issue and has shipped remediation guidance or updates. Defenders should therefore treat the CVE as authoritative and prioritize mapping it to their per‑SKU KBs and update channels. (msrc.microsoft.com)
Caveats:
  • MSRC entries sometimes omit low‑level exploit mechanics; that is an intentional policy to avoid assisting attackers. A “confirmed” vendor entry with a high confidence rating signifies the vendor has validated the fix; it does not always mean the public will see a full technical root‑cause writeup. Use the vendor advisory and published patches as the canonical remediation source. (msrc.microsoft.com)

What organizations should do now — prioritized action checklist​

  • Inventory impacted endpoints
  • Identify machines that run Windows versions where Device Association Service is present (modern Windows 10 and Windows 11 client SKUs and any server SKUs that include device‑pairing features). Prioritize user workstations and shared kiosks.
  • Map CVE→KB
  • Use Microsoft’s Security Update Guide and your update management tooling to resolve the exact KB articles that correspond to your build numbers and SKUs. Do not rely solely on CVE identifiers when targeting update packages; MSRC’s interactive KB mappings are authoritative. (msrc.microsoft.com)
  • Test and stage
  • Validate updates in a test cohort before broad deployment. Because this affects a system service that integrates with device pairing, verify user workflows (Bluetooth, Nearby Sharing, device pairing, corporate device management flows) in the test group.
  • Deploy rapidly
  • Treat this as a high‑priority patch for your endpoints, especially those used by administrators or high‑value users. EoP patches are standard escalation targets after initial compromise.
  • Monitor for indicators
  • Look for anomalous local privilege escalation activities, suspicious scheduled tasks or service installers, and EDR alerts for processes interacting with DeviceAssociation service or related device pairing APIs. Preserve event logs and EDR telemetry for any suspected incidents.
  • Compensating controls (if immediate patching is impossible)
  • Limit local admin privileges where feasible.
  • Harden endpoint security by enforcing application control policies, least privilege, and endpoint detection and response.
  • Temporarily restrict untrusted local code execution via application control policies and privilege separation. These steps reduce attack surface but are not substitutes for patching.

Detection guidance: what to look for in your logs and telemetry​

  • Process creation events where unprivileged user processes spawn installers or attempt service modifications.
  • Unexpected calls to device pairing APIs or unusual RPC/Broker service activity tied to Device Association processes.
  • EDR signals for memory‑corruption behavior in DeviceAssociation process space or rapid thread‑creation patterns that could indicate race‑condition exploitation attempts.
Because race exploits typically succeed through precise timing and may trigger crashes or instability before a successful privilege gain, look for repeated crashes of service host processes, correlated with local‑user activity. Preserve memory and system artifacts whenever you suspect an escalation event for forensic analysis.

Patch management and deployment recommendations​

  • Align emergency patching windows with business risk profiles: prioritize admin consoles, jump boxes, and high‑privilege user devices first, then general user endpoints.
  • Use your existing enterprise update tools (WSUS, SCCM/ConfigMgr, Intune) to approve per‑SKU updates. Confirm package IDs against Microsoft’s Security Update Guide before mass deployment. (msrc.microsoft.com)
  • After patching, validate service behavior and user‑facing device pairing flows. Report regressions through normal vendor channels; maintain rollout telemetry to detect any unexpected functional impact.
  • Keep an eye on vendor guidance for any revised advisories — sometimes vendors reclassify confidence or adjust affected SKUs as more telemetry arrives.

Risk analysis: strength and weaknesses of the advisory​

Strengths
  • The vendor has acknowledged and patched the flaw, which is the most important mitigation. An official patch removes the urgency of creating custom mitigations and provides a reliable remediation path. (msrc.microsoft.com)
  • Independent trackers and reputable security outlets have reproduced the vendor’s classification and scoring, giving defenders multiple corroborating views for triage prioritization.
Weaknesses / Open questions
  • Microsoft’s public advisory may intentionally be terse about exploit mechanics; defenders cannot fully assess how easy or brittle a practical exploit would be without additional technical disclosure. That ambiguity complicates internal risk scoring beyond the vendor’s severity label. (msrc.microsoft.com)
  • No public PoC reduces short‑term exploitation risk, but sophisticated threat actors can produce private weaponization quickly — especially for race conditions once a dependable trigger pattern is reverse engineered. The absence of an observed in‑the‑wild exploit should not be construed as permanent safety.
Flag: any claims about exploit code availability or active exploitation should be treated with caution until independent proof or incident telemetry appears. At the time of publication, trackers report no PoC and no confirmed active exploitation.

Contextual history: why Device Association bugs repeat​

Device pairing and companion device services are complex pieces of user‑facing infrastructure that must balance interoperability, user convenience, and security. They routinely interact with hardware drivers, user prompts, and system‑level privilege transitions — a recipe for subtle synchronization and memory‑management errors. The Device Association area has seen prior EoP advisories (for example, CVE‑2025‑55677 in the Device Association Broker) that demonstrate both the functional complexity and the historical attack surface in this subsystem. That history is why defenders should take any DeviceAssociation advisory seriously even when exploit details are sparse.

Practical guidance for security teams and IT operations​

  • Incident Response playbook update:
  • Add CVE‑2026‑24295 to your EoP triage list and ensure IR teams have a runbook for preserving volatile evidence before patching affected endpoints in suspected compromises.
  • Threat hunting queries:
  • Hunt for anomalous local privilege changes, service installs, and repeated DeviceAssociation crashes or restarts correlated to unprivileged user activity.
  • Search EDR telemetry for threads that attempt to manipulate device pairing states or call into the DeviceAssociation service from unexpected processes.
  • Communications:
  • Notify end users that the update is part of standard security maintenance and emphasize the importance of installing it promptly; for mobile or BYOD devices managed through corporate MDM, ensure compliance policies require the update.

Final assessment and recommendation​

CVE‑2026‑24295 is a confirmed, vendor‑addressed elevation‑of‑privilege vulnerability in the Windows Device Association Service caused by a race‑condition‑type flaw. The bug is locally exploitable by an authorized user and carries an Important severity rating (around CVSS 7.0 in public trackers). While no public proof‑of‑concept or confirmed in‑the‑wild exploitation was reported at disclosure, the existence of a vendor patch makes remediation straightforward: inventory, map CVE→KB for your SKUs, test in staged cohorts, and deploy widely — prioritizing high‑value endpoints and administrative devices. (msrc.microsoft.com)
Short, practical checklist (summary)
  • Confirm which systems in your estate run the Device Association Service and map affected builds.
  • Identify the exact KBs for your Windows builds and approve them in your update system. (msrc.microsoft.com)
  • Test the update in a small group, validate device pairing flows, then stage broad deployment.
  • Hunt for unusual local privilege escalations and preserve forensic evidence for any suspicious host prior to remediation.
Administrators who follow these steps will minimize their risk exposure from CVE‑2026‑24295 while avoiding operational disruption. Treat the MSRC advisory as the authoritative source for KB mapping, rely on vendor patches rather than speculative mitigations, and continue monitoring trusted security trackers for any updates, exploit disclosures, or revised vendor guidance. (msrc.microsoft.com)

Cautionary note: some public trackers summarize vendor data; when a precise build‑to‑KB mapping matters for deployment, always verify against Microsoft’s Security Update Guide and the Update Catalog as the final authoritative mapping. (msrc.microsoft.com)
Conclusion: CVE‑2026‑24295 is a serious local privilege‑escalation bug in a device‑facing Windows service that has been acknowledged and patched by Microsoft. The absence of a public PoC lowers immediate exploitation likelihood, but the operational value of such an EoP means enterprises should treat the patch as high priority and follow the triage, testing, and deployment steps outlined above. (msrc.microsoft.com)

Source: MSRC Security Update Guide - Microsoft Security Response Center